Record and development:
On-line poker appeared when you look at the belated 1990s as a result of breakthroughs in technology and net. 1st online poker room, globe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a small but passionate neighborhood. However, it was in early 2000s that internet poker practiced exponential growth, mostly as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Features of Internet Poker:
Online poker provides several advantages over conventional brick-and-mortar casinos. Firstly, it offers a larger variety of game choices, including different poker variations and stakes, providing to your tastes and spending plans of all types of people. Also, on-line poker rooms are available 24/7, getting rid of the limitations of real casino running hours. In addition, web systems frequently provide appealing incentives, commitment programs, therefore the capability to play multiple tables simultaneously, enhancing the overall gaming experience.
